1e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bachifneq ($(TARGET_SIMULATOR),true)
2e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bach
3e448862a47c08eb23185aaed574b39264f5005fcAndre EisenbachLOCAL_PATH:= $(call my-dir)
4e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bach
5e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bachinclude $(CLEAR_VARS)
6e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bach
7e448862a47c08eb23185aaed574b39264f5005fcAndre EisenbachLOCAL_C_INCLUDES:= $(LOCAL_PATH)/common \
8e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bach                   $(LOCAL_PATH)/ulinux \
9e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bach                   $(LOCAL_PATH)/../include \
10127248594c6b24235aa233237d5cd27cb584d6d8Wink Saville                   $(LOCAL_PATH)/../stack/include \
11520b756328dcf4a54cf25f5d16177aa17fdbce31Matthew Xie                   $(LOCAL_PATH)/../utils/include \
12127248594c6b24235aa233237d5cd27cb584d6d8Wink Saville                   $(bdroid_C_INCLUDES) \
13e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bach
14127248594c6b24235aa233237d5cd27cb584d6d8Wink SavilleLOCAL_CFLAGS += -Werror $(bdroid_CFLAGS)
15e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bach
16e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bachifeq ($(BOARD_HAVE_BLUETOOTH_BCM),true)
17e448862a47c08eb23185aaed574b39264f5005fcAndre EisenbachLOCAL_CFLAGS += \
186ef101187774e30ddba6b46bbedef549a42196adAndre Eisenbach	-DBOARD_HAVE_BLUETOOTH_BCM
19e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bachendif
20e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bach
21e448862a47c08eb23185aaed574b39264f5005fcAndre EisenbachLOCAL_PRELINK_MODULE:=false
22e448862a47c08eb23185aaed574b39264f5005fcAndre EisenbachLOCAL_SRC_FILES:= \
23e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bach    ./ulinux/gki_ulinux.c \
24e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bach    ./common/gki_debug.c \
25e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bach    ./common/gki_time.c \
266ef101187774e30ddba6b46bbedef549a42196adAndre Eisenbach    ./common/gki_buffer.c
276ef101187774e30ddba6b46bbedef549a42196adAndre Eisenbach
286ef101187774e30ddba6b46bbedef549a42196adAndre EisenbachLOCAL_MODULE := libbt-brcm_gki
2984a000f59a48dac41d04da6bf9569258bc0e2cfcKausik SinnaswamyLOCAL_MODULE_TAGS := optional
30e448862a47c08eb23185aaed574b39264f5005fcAndre EisenbachLOCAL_SHARED_LIBRARIES := libcutils libc
3187564f3972ffbb4106682f7b6e88110fbe76004fAndre EisenbachLOCAL_MODULE_CLASS := STATIC_LIBRARIES
3287564f3972ffbb4106682f7b6e88110fbe76004fAndre Eisenbach
33e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bachinclude $(BUILD_STATIC_LIBRARY)
34e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bach
35e448862a47c08eb23185aaed574b39264f5005fcAndre Eisenbachendif  # TARGET_SIMULATOR != true
36